Honey BBQ Chicken Wings Recipe for Sticky, Crispy Flavor

Honey BBQ Chicken Wings deliver the ideal combination of crispy skin, juicy meat, and a sweet, sticky glaze. These wings build flavor in layers: a simple dry rub on the chicken, each piece wrapped in thin-cut bacon, slow-smoked over hickory, then briefly deep-fried for a perfect finish. The result is a balanced, complex wing that’s ideal for summer cookouts, game-day gatherings, or casual dinners.

Start with an even mix of flats and drums—both have their merits, and together they make a well-rounded platter. Place 2 lbs of chicken wings in a large bowl and season them with the dry rub (Kosher salt, black pepper, garlic powder, onion powder, smoked paprika, and chili powder). Toss well to ensure even coverage.

Slice a 1 lb pack of thin-cut bacon in half and wrap each seasoned wing with a half-strip of bacon. Secure the bacon with toothpicks (soak toothpicks in water for 20 minutes to prevent burning). This bacon wrapping adds fat and flavor while the wings smoke.

Preheat a smoker to 250°F and add hickory chunks for a classic smoky aroma. Place the bacon-wrapped wings on the smoker and smoke for 40–45 minutes, checking internal temperature as you go. Remove from the smoker when the wings reach about 155°F internal—the frying step will finish them to a safe temperature while crisping the exterior.smoking chicken wings

HOW TO MAKE HONEY BBQ WINGS SAUCE

While the wings smoke, make the honey BBQ sauce. In a medium saucepan, combine 1 cup ketchup, 1/4 cup apple cider vinegar, 1/4 cup honey, 1/4 cup brown sugar, 2 tbsp Worcestershire sauce, 2 tsp kosher salt, 2 tsp onion powder, 2 tsp garlic powder, 2 tsp smoked paprika, 2 tsp red pepper flakes, and 1 tsp black pepper. Whisk over medium heat for 6–8 minutes until smooth and slightly reduced, then let the sauce cool to room temperature. The cooled sauce will coat the wings without thinning out too much.honey bbq sauce

FRYING CHICKEN WINGS

Prepare a frying station before the wings are done smoking. Heat about 3 pounds of lard (or your preferred frying fat) in a Dutch oven or deep fryer to 375°F. Once the smoked wings reach 155°F internal, fry them in batches of about six for 3–4 minutes each. This quick fry crisps the bacon and skin while finishing the meat to a safe internal temperature.

After frying, transfer the wings to a large bowl and toss with the cooled honey BBQ sauce until evenly coated. Plate and serve immediately for the best texture and flavor.fried chicken wings

Honey BBQ Chicken Wings Recipe

Servings: 8

Prep Time: 10 mins • Cook Time: 1 hr 10 mins • Total Time: 1 hr 20 mins

Ingredients

  • 2 lbs chicken wings (flats and drums)
  • 1 lb thin-cut bacon, sliced in half
  • Toothpicks (soaked 20 minutes)

Chicken Dry Rub

  • 1 tbsp Kosher salt
  • 1 tbsp black pepper
  • 2 tsp garlic powder
  • 2 tsp onion powder
  • 1 tsp smoked paprika
  • 1 tsp chili powder

Honey BBQ Sauce

  • 1 cup ketchup
  • 1/4 cup apple cider vinegar
  • 1/4 cup honey
  • 1/4 cup brown sugar
  • 2 tbsp Worcestershire sauce
  • 2 tsp kosher salt
  • 2 tsp onion powder
  • 2 tsp garlic powder
  • 2 tsp smoked paprika
  • 2 tsp red pepper flakes
  • 1 tsp black pepper

Instructions

  1. Prepare the wings by trimming and patting them dry. Combine the dry rub ingredients and season the wings evenly.
  2. Wrap each seasoned wing with a half-strip of bacon and secure with a toothpick.
  3. Preheat a smoker to 250°F, add hickory wood chunks, and smoke the wings for 40–45 minutes or until they reach 155°F internal.
  4. While smoking, make the sauce: combine all sauce ingredients in a saucepan, whisk over medium heat for 6–8 minutes, then cool to room temperature.
  5. Set up a fryer and heat lard or oil to 375°F. Fry smoked wings in batches of six for 3–4 minutes until crisp. Drain briefly and transfer to a large bowl.
  6. Toss the fried wings with the cooled honey BBQ sauce until evenly coated. Plate and serve immediately.
  7. Garnish with chopped green onions or sesame seeds if desired, and enjoy with your favorite dipping sauce.
